Wolfenstein Parametrization Re-examined
Abstract
The Wolfenstein parametrization of the Kobayashi-Maskawa (KM) matrix is modified by keeping its unitarity up to the accuracy of . This modification can self-consistently lead to the off-diagonal asymmetry of : = with , which is comparable in magnitude with the Jarlskog parameter of violation . We constrain the ranges of and by using the current experimental data, and point out that the possibility of a symmetric KM matrix has almost been ruled out.
